    Quote Originally Posted by Kisa View Post
    Hmm I could give wax worms a try too in the mineral oil thing doesn't work. The only thing I'm scared about with force feeding him the oil is that there's a risk of it going down the wrong pipe, getting into his lungs and causing pneumonia. D: And THAT we really don't want. I'm not confident enough that I won't make him sick, so I think I'm going to give what Don said to do a try. Hopefully I can get the crickets to stay still and relax while I put the mineral oil on them...
    Put the oil in 8 oz or so cup, drop cricket in and swirl him around, He'll be dizzy and then put him right in front of Bruce.

    I got mineral oil, not castor. I noticed at the store that they're too different things, one is called an "intestinal lubricant" and the other (castor) was a straight up laxative, so I got the weaker one just in case. I don't wanna hurt his little belly.

    The vet told me I could use the syringe I used for when I was giving him thew antibiotics and fill it to the 1 ml line. (I think it's ml, I'm not 100% sure though, but I will try Don's idea.)

    So it's not safe to dip more than one cricket? Should I just do one and leave it and wait and see what happens? It says on the back of mineral oil bottle that it takes 6 to 8 hours for the effects to kick in.
